Big Timber rests in a broad valley, cradled by the rugged, snow-capped peaks of the Absaroka-Beartooth Wilderness. It lies 53.3 miles east-north-east of Bozeman, MT (from Bozeman, MT: bearing 78°T), and is situated 31.5 miles east-north-east of Livingston. This region has long been a crossroads, first for indigenous peoples who followed the game across these fertile valleys, and later for the pioneers who arrived seeking opportunity in the vast Montana Territory. The Northern Pacific Railway’s arrival in the late 19th century solidified Big Timber’s place as a vital hub, its economy built on ranching, agriculture, and the timber industry that once thrived in the surrounding forests. Though the logging camps have largely faded, the spirit of hard work and self-reliance remains, evident in the local ranches that continue to raise cattle and the small businesses that form the backbone of Big Timber. The annual Sweet Grass County Fair is a cherished tradition, a vibrant celebration of the agricultural heritage and the close-knit community that defines this enduring corner of Montana.
